There are already THREE lapidary-related lists:

Faceter’s Digest, “subscribe” to Jerry Dewbre
faceters@ix.netcom.com

– THE list for faceters. EVERYBODY welcome, from world-famous
pros to newbies like myself.

Lapidary Digest, “SUBSCRIBE DIGEST” to Lapidary@mindspring.com

– For all NON-FACETING lapidary interests.

Gems & Facets, subscribe at http://www.gemdata.com/

– For all gem related interests.
